At Fiskars Group, we’ve been creating products that bring joy, purpose, and performance to everyday life for over 375 years. From iconic brands to thoughtful design, we believe great decisions—rooted in strong insights—drive sustainable growth. That’s where you come in.
We’re looking for a Financial Analyst Intern to support our Americas Sales Finance team. This is a fantastic opportunity to gain hands-on experience analyzing financial data, supporting decision-making, and learning the inner workings of a global consumer products organization.
What You’ll Do
As an intern, you’ll work closely with Sales, Marketing, and Finance teams, contributing to projects that help drive profitable growth and improve business insights. Your responsibilities will include:
- Supporting Sales and Marketing with analysis of customer programs, promotions, and profitability
- Assisting with sales forecasting, budgeting, and variance analysis
- Helping prepare monthly reporting packages and business reviews for leadership
- Conducting ad-hoc analyses to identify trends, risks, and opportunities
- Assisting with account reconciliations, trade accrual tracking, and issue resolution
- Supporting pricing management and customer dispute analysis
- Contributing to process improvement initiatives across the Sales Finance function
What You Bring
- Currently pursuing a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a keen attention to detail
- Comfort working with Excel; experience with SAP, Power BI, or other data tools is a plus
- Strong commun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ively in a team environment
- Curiosity and eagerness to learn about financial analysis and business operations

Pioneering design to make the everyday extraordinary
Fiskars Group (FSKRS, Nasdaq Helsinki) is the global home of design-driven brands for indoor and outdoor living. Since 1649, we have designed products of timeless, purposeful, and functional beauty, while driving innovation and sustainable growth. In 2024, Fiskars Group’s global net sales were EUR 1.2 billion and we had close to 7,000 employees. We have two Business Areas (BA), Vita and Fiskars.
BA Vita offers premium and luxury products for the tableware, drinkware, jewelry and interior categories. Its well-known brands include Georg Jensen, Royal Copenhagen, Wedgwood, Moomin Arabia, Iittala and Waterford. In 2024, BA Vita’s reported net sales were EUR 605 million. Already 50% of BA Vita’s net sales comes from direct-to-consumer sales, comprising approximately 500 stores and approximately 60 e-commerce sites.
BA Fiskars consists of the gardening and outdoor categories, in addition to the scissors and creating, as well as cooking categories. The brands include Fiskars and Gerber. In 2024, BA Fiskars’ net sales were EUR 547 million.
